tenor
adjective
1. (of a musical instrument) intermediate between alto and baritone or bass
- a tenor sax
Similar word(s): high
2. of or close in range to the highest natural adult male voice
- tenor voice
Similar word(s): high

noun
1. the adult male singing voice above baritone
Definition categories: communication
2. the pitch range of the highest male voice
Definition categories: attribute, pitch
3. an adult male with a tenor voice
Definition categories: person, singer, vocalist, vocalizer
4. a settled or prevailing or habitual course of a person's life
- nothing disturbed the even tenor of her ways
Definition categories: thought, direction
5. the general meaning or substance of an utterance
- although I disagreed with him I could follow the tenor of his argument
